The only real difference I can see with having a Journalist role is a level of legitimacy. The idea that they are paid by the corporation to report on news or produce propaganda. Newcasters are easy to use and cameras can be printed from autolathes now so they aren't even a rare resource. The Curator has a nice PDA cartridge that allows them to post Newcaster articles from their PDAs but lacks the ability to attach photos so I never used it. Blogger gimmick really is easiest to do from the position of a bored Assistant. Even if we did get a journalist role I would probably end up ignoring it and keep rolling assistant so I can just drop the gimmick when I get bored and keep my maint access.

People don't report on things because they don't think people will read it. The only time I've ever read the news is when someone threw a newspaper at me and told me I was in it.
I think that making the news more important in the metagame would be nice, since then there would be a reason to read it. I think that a reporter would really help inform the crew on the current happenings too. Sometimes I go the whole round not knowing what antag is on the station because I am working on other things, maybe the reporter could fix this issue (although I think it's my fault for not getting involved).
I think maybe instead of having the newscaster say "A new report is available!" or whatever it is, say the title of the article that was just published. This would encourage the sort of actual reporter habits that we see nowadays. We'd see clickbaits, trolls, misleading articles, as well as actual decent reporting. So instead of "A new report is available" make it, "New report by Giggles the Clown: Captain is confirmed comdom." I think a small adjustment like that would make a big difference. Restrict it to 32 characters or something small. Make sure that the person reporting it is listed, so you know when you see the clown's name not to take it seriously.
